The Lightning connector is used to connect Apple mobile devices like iPhones, iPads, and iPods to host computers, external monitors, cameras, USB battery chargers, and other peripherals. Using 8 pins instead of 30, Lightning is much smaller than its predecessor. See moreThe Lightning port keeps the iPhone 13 tied to Apple’s limited ecosystem. The method to force restart your iPhone will differ depending on your iPhone …The Lightning port is primarily employed for charging iOS devices, but can also carry data to and from connected Macs or PCs. Lightning cables are also able to power connected devices – great ...An 8-pin lightning connector is used to connect Apple devices like iPhones, iPad, and iPods to computers, laptops, USB battery chargers, or other peripherals via a Lightning cable. The lightning cable comes with an 8-pin symmetrical connector. It is an industry standard that defines the cables, connectors, and the ...Tap your iPhone gently against your hand with the connector facing down to remove excess liquid. Leave your iPhone in a dry area with some airflow. After at least 30 minutes, try charging with a Lightning or USB-C cable or connecting an accessory. Among Lightning connectors, the Lightning-to-USB is the most versatile for …The Thunderbolt 3 (USB-C) port is available on some newer Intel-based Mac computers. Mac computers with Apple silicon have either the Thunderbolt / USB 4 port or the Thunderbolt 4 (USB-C) port , depending on the model. The ports allow data transfer, video output, and charging through the same cable. It ...Inspect Your iPhone's Charging Port (Lightning Port) You should frequently inspect your Lightning port, also known as the charging port, to make sure it is clean. Lint, gunk, and other debris can prevent your Lightning port from making a solid connection with your Lightning cable.
